#44d650 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#44d650 is composed of 26.7% red, 83.9%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.6%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 124.9 degrees, a saturation of 64% and a lightness of 55.3%. #44d650 color hex could be obtained by blending #88ffa0 with #00ad00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

#44d650 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#44d650 has RGB values of R:68, G:214,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.68, M:0, Y:0.63,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 4511312.

Shades and Tints of #44d650
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010602 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f6 is the lightest one.
